ERP Technical Lead / Systems Analyst
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
What You’ll Do
ERP Management & Support
Manage and support Epicor Kinetic, ensuring stability, performance, and scalability
Troubleshoot and resolve complex ERP issues (customizations, BAQs, BPMs, APIs)
Perform root cause analysis and optimize system performance (SQL tuning, indexing)
Reporting & Dashboards
Build and maintain BAQs and dashboards for executives, operations, and shop floor users
Deliver performance-optimized, secure, and reusable data solutions using Epicor tools or integrations (e.g., GROW)
UI Customization
Create and maintain custom UI components using Application Studio (pages, fields, logic, widgets)
Ensure changes are resilient to upgrades and well-documented
Automation & Business Logic
Develop BPMs and Epicor Functions to automate processes and enforce business rules
Ensure testing and rollback plans are in place for all deployments
Integrations & APIs
Implement and maintain integrations using Service Connect, REST/OData APIs, or middleware
Manage API security, keys, scopes, and access control
Governance & Documentation
Own version control, deployment records, and documentation across all ERP customizations
Enforce change management processes including testing and rollback procedures
Training & Knowledge Sharing
Train internal users to reduce reliance on external consultants
Create user guides, runbooks, and conduct knowledge-transfer sessions
Upgrades & Continuous Improvement
Lead technical tasks during Epicor upgrades and patches
Coordinate regression testing and validate compatibility of custom components
Stay up to date with Epicor’s roadmap and roll out new features
What You Bring
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, IT, Engineering, or equivalent experience
3 years of technical Epicor Kinetic experience — ideally in a semiconductor or manufacturing environment
Hands-on experience with Service Connect, REST/OData APIs, and ERP integrations
Familiarity with modern web development concepts (Angular, TypeScript, .NET)
Strong troubleshooting, support, and ERP governance skills
